Output c8e3fc30b6de7508ca5edc805ec29e0563f323937313019aa617e2f77ea711c5:1

value
956767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89f585c4498fe114c1895577bb139b2a34387ba OP_EQUAL
address
3MSQmUVTBNL7Mw98fjoAaGaA7iVkjftKZ2
transaction
c8e3fc30b6de7508ca5edc805ec29e0563f323937313019aa617e2f77ea711c5
spent
true